<br /> RESOLUTION NO. 6-01
<br /> A RESOLUTION OF THE TOWN OF LOS ALTOS HILLS CONSENTING TO
<br /> THE SALE AND TRANSFER OF A NON-EXCLUSIVE CABLE TELEVISON
<br /> FRANCHISE FROM PACIFIC SUN CABLE PARTNERS, L.P., TO TCI OF
<br /> PENNSYLVANIA, INC. AND AUTHORIZING EXECUTION OF AN
<br /> ASSUMPTION AGREEMENT
<br /> WHEREAS, On June 21, 1988,the Town adopted Franchise Procedural Ordinance
<br /> No. 323 wherein the Town was authorized to grant one or more non-exclusive franchises
<br /> to operate a Cable Televison System within the Town subject to certain provisions, terms
<br /> and conditions; and
<br /> WHEREAS, on June 21, 1988, by adoption of Ordinance No. 324,the Town granted
<br /> to Sun Country Cable, Inc., a California Corporation ("Sun Country"), a non-exclusive
<br /> franchise for a period of fifteen years from the date of acceptance of the franchise on terms
<br /> and conditions set forth therein, to install, construct, reconstruct, operate, and maintain a
<br /> cable communications system ("System") within the Town; and
<br /> WHEREAS, on June 21, 1988, Sun Country and the Town entered into and
<br /> executed an Agreement entitled "AN AGREEMENT GRANTING A NON-EXCLUSIVE
<br /> FRANCHISE TO SUN COUNTRY CABLE, INC. TO OPERATE A CABLE TELEVISON
<br /> SYSTEM IN THE CITY OF LOS ALTOS HILLS AND SETTING FORTH CONDITIONS
<br /> ACCOMPANYING THE GRANTING OF THE FRANCHISE," ("Franchise"); and
<br /> WHEREAS, On January 9, 1989, by adoption of Resolution 5-89, the Town
<br /> consented to the sale and transfer of the Franchise described above to Pacific Sun Cable
<br /> Partners, L.P., ("Pacific Sun/Franchisee"); and
<br /> WHEREAS, on June 3, 1999, by adoption of Resolution 31-99,the Town consented
<br /> to the sale and transfer of the Franchise from Pacific Sun/Franchisee to SunTel
<br /> Communications, LLC,a Delaware Limited Liability Corporation("SunTel")and in so doing,
<br /> the Town, Pacific Sun/Franchisee and SunTel entered into a certain Franchise Assumption
<br /> Agreement, dated July 1, 1999; and
<br /> WHEREAS, Pacific Sun/Franchisee has represented to the Town that the transfer
<br /> of the Franchise from Pacific Sun/Franchisee to SunTel was never consummated and that
<br /> Pacific Sun/Franchisee still holds'the Franchise; and
<br /> WHEREAS, Pacific Sun/Franchisee now desires to sell and transfer the Franchise
<br /> to TCI of Pennsylvania, Inc., a Pennsylvania Corporation ("TCI"); and
<br /> WHEREAS, Franchise Procedural Ordinance No. 323 section 4.6(a) requires that
<br /> prior consent of the City Council ("Council") must be obtained in connection with the sale,
<br /> transfer, or disposition of any Cable Television Franchise; and
